Lincecum May Go for the Jackpot in Arbitration

Tim Brown of Yahoo Sports is putting out a scenario where Tim Lincecum could potentially ask for over $20 million in his side of arbitration.

Both the Giants and Lincecum’s agent are preparing their arbitration figures and we will know soon how much each side is offering to sign for.

As an example to consider, Yankee captain Derk Jeter filed for $18.5 million before agreeing to a 10-year, $189-million contract. Lincecum and his agent are receptive to signing a contract extension, so we’ll see if both sides can hammer something out.
